Output 2675f2961e35161022e7faf2c80c791b4f26f6a3f58f9c5b4e1beb7764e478bb:1

value
784380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5eb8185d81acf7666800cc93661d7d498ef5b9e OP_EQUAL
address
3MC7yeJ1oDGe6aCYGagXAKxRFwuu4DTcm6
transaction
2675f2961e35161022e7faf2c80c791b4f26f6a3f58f9c5b4e1beb7764e478bb
spent
true